COH 606: Epidemiology
Journal Article Presentation Rubric
Find a peer-reviewed article that uses epidemiological methods to examine a health-related issue, and make a 10-minute presentation to the class.
MHA PLOs: Solve complex problems in a healthcare environment by employing analytical skills; Utilize administrative and clinical information technology and decision-support tools in process and performance improvement;
MPH PLOs: Analyze and interpret health data; Describe the distribution and determinants of disease, disabilities and death in human populations.
Course Learning Outcomes:
Upon completion of this course the student will be able to:
· Appropriately use and understand epidemiological terminology.
· Determine appropriate epidemiological study designs
· Identify sources of bias in public health research.
· Discuss the steps of an disease outbreak investigation
· Critically review the public health literature.
